    When it comes to headers, why not just bend the pipe from one end to the other instead of making a bunch of 180s and cutting them up and welding them back together?

    • @TrickTools
      @TrickTools  3 ปีที่แล้ว +5

      If you have a mandrel bender at your disposal then that would be the best route. Mandrel bending machines are quite expensive and most shops can't justify the cost so buying U bends from suppliers that mass produce and sell them is the most cost efficient way to get mandrel bent tubing for headers.
